Description of the walk

Departure from Doulezon at the church and cemetery car park.

(S/E) From the car park, head towards the central crossroads in Doulezon (the three routes are marked with green, red and yellow arrows painted by our cheerful Doulezon residents), turn left onto Rue Le Bourg Sud, then immediately right down the hill towards Micouleau and Le Touron. Ignore the two paths on the right and continue downhill.
Pass a family tomb, then an old wash house. Continue along the shaded road beside the Touron spring, where the climate seems tropical. Go to the crossroads at the bottom of the descent.

at the intersection, take the road on the left, passing in front of the Escouach watermill. At the next crossroads, continue straight on along the road, which further on makes a sharp left turn to arrive at Le Souquet and its ruined house.

(2) At the crossroads, head north and, 200 metres further on, turn right towards Caillouade. Leave the house on your right and continue through the vineyards to reach the path leading to the hamlet of Rieux and then the D21.

(3) Continue straight ahead, along the vineyards, then along the woods. Join the road and turn right at the dead oak tree until you reach the crossroads.

(4) Turn left following the yellow arrow, follow the vineyard path and descend on the left, heading west-northwest towards Langragnat. Cross this hamlet and continue to the next intersection.

(5) Turn right, heading north-west towards Doulezon, cross the Descot stream to reach the recently restored Chotelle wash house. At the next intersection, turn right towards Descot. Note some pretty houses before arriving behind the church of Doulezon. (S/E)

Worth a visit

(S/E) Notre-Dame Church
Doulezon also has an important Gallo-Roman villa covering nearly three hectares.
(2) Noble house of Laurée.
Mission cross in front of Caillouade.
At the Caillouade house, gavache well (covered and closed well).
(3) Tomb with epitaph in Rieux.
(5) Langragnat with its beautiful houses and an old blocked well and, 500 metres from (5), an old dovecote in Descot.

a short, easy and pleasant walk around Doulezon and its pretty church. There is a large square with space for several vehicles. The roads are very quiet except for the last section, but this is essential if you want to visit the wash house. The paths are passable even after two months of rain. Note the excellent and amusing signage in place, which means you can leave your mobile phone in your pocket. There is just one "error" between the GPS and the signage at point 4. You must follow the signage that goes around the house.
